Kenji Notsu is affiliated with the University of Tokyo in Japan, focusing research primarily within the fields of physics and astronomy as well as environmental science.
Their recent scholarly work includes a paper titled "Secular variations in helium isotope ratios in Izu Oshima volcano", published in 2021 in the venue Goldschmidt2021 abstracts.
